Gavita vs The Rest: What I've Learned from Buying Horticultural Lighting for 5 Years

The Lighting Decision That Keeps Coming Up

I manage purchasing for a 40-person greenhouse operation—roughly $200K annually across 8 vendors for everything from substrates to irrigation. But the category that generates the most questions (and arguments) is lighting. Specifically: should we standardize on Gavita or consider alternatives?

When I took over purchasing in 2020, we were running a mix of older HPS fixtures and a few early LED units. Every winter, someone would complain about uneven canopy growth, and every summer, someone wanted to "try something new." So I started tracking what actually worked—and what didn't.

This isn't an exhaustive comparison of every horticultural light on the market. It's a practical look at three scenarios I've dealt with personally: high-end LED fixtures (Gavita Pro RS 2400e), plasma grow lights, and budget LED strips. The key dimensions I'll compare are: light spectrum quality, energy efficiency, durability, and total cost over a 3-year period.

Dimension 1: Spectrum Quality — Gavita vs Plasma vs LED Strip

Gavita Pro RS 2400e LED

The 2400e is a full-spectrum fixture with a very even distribution. Our head grower ran PAR maps on a 4x4 canopy and found less than 5% variation across the footprint. The spectrum includes far-red diodes, which we noticed improved flowering response in our cannabis strains by about 7-10% compared to the older HPS setup.

If I remember correctly, the 2400e uses Osram and Samsung diodes—industry-standard components. The fixture maintains consistent output even after 18+ months of daily use. Bottom line: exceptional spectrum quality, but you're paying for it.

Gavita Plasma Grow Light

The plasma option is interesting but niche. I've only tested one unit for a side-by-side trial. The spectrum is incredibly close to natural sunlight—some growers swear by it for propagation and young plants. But the upfront cost is high, and the bulb has a limited lifespan (roughly 10,000 hours according to the spec sheet).

The surprise was how much heat the plasma unit generated. We expected LED-level cool operation, but it ran closer to HPS temperatures. If you're doing sensitive propagation, maybe consider it. But for production flowering? Not convinced.

Budget LED Strip

I'm not talking about the cheap, unbranded strips you find on Amazon. I mean mid-range LED strips from reputable horticulture vendors—not Gavita, but still legitimate. The spectrum is usually okay for vegetative growth, but we saw significant drop-off in the red wavelengths after 6-8 months. Most buyers focus on initial brightness and completely miss spectrum degradation over time.

People assume LED strips are the budget solution that "just works." The reality is they can work, but you have to replace them more often, and the cumulative cost adds up.

"The question everyone asks is 'how many watts?' The question they should ask is 'how stable is the spectrum after one year?'"

Dimension 2: Energy Efficiency — The Real Cost

Gavita Pro RS 2400e

We calculated our cost per gram of dried flower production. The 2400e runs at roughly 2.2 μmol/J, which puts it at the top of the efficiency chart for commercial fixtures. In our 3-year projection, the Gavita units paid back their higher upfront cost through electricity savings alone—about $140 per fixture per year compared to the old HPS setup.

Never expected the budget vendor to outperform the premium one on this dimension. Turns out, premium fixtures are premium for a reason—the efficiency math really works at scale.

Gavita Plasma

The plasma unit was less efficient—around 1.5 μmol/J. That's better than HPS but significantly behind the LED fixtures. If your electricity cost is above $0.10/kWh, the math gets ugly fast.

Budget LED Strip

We tested one brand of LED strips that claimed 2.0 μmol/J. Our PAR meter showed about 1.7 μmol/J at best. The vendor's specs were... optimistic, to put it charitably. Let me rephrase that: the specs were inflated. We ended up needing 30% more strip length to hit target PPFD levels.

Total cost of ownership is what matters. But you can't calculate it without real data. When the budget option is under-spec'd, you don't save money—you just spend it differently.

Dimension 3: Durability and Maintenance (The Part Nobody Talks About)

Gavita Pro RS 2400e

After two years of daily use in a humid greenhouse (50-70% RH), every Gavita unit we bought is still running at spec. No driver failures, no diode burn-out. The IP65 rating is real—we had a sprinkler malfunction near one fixture, and it survived. Durability is where Gavita earns its premium.

Gavita Plasma

Bulb replacement after ~10,000 hours adds $250+ per unit every year or two depending on usage. The fixture itself is well-built, but the consumable cost caught us off guard. If I were to use plasma again, I'd only use it for specific, short-duration applications—not as a primary light source.

Budget LED Strip

We had two failures in the first year out of 12 strips purchased. Both were driver failures—one was replaced under warranty (took 5 weeks), and we just wrote off the other. The remaining strips showed noticeable output decline after 12 months. The upfront saving was eaten by replacement costs and downtime.

Scenario-Based Recommendations (No "One Best" Answer)

After managing lighting procurement for five years, here's how I'd break it down:

Choose Gavita Pro RS 2400e if:

  • You need consistent, high-quality light for flowering cannabis or high-value crops.
  • Your operation is at least 1,000 sq ft and electricity costs matter.
  • You value reliability over upfront savings.
  • You have a maintenance budget that can handle premium fixtures.

Consider Gavita Plasma only if:

  • You're running a small propagation space (under 200 sq ft).
  • You want to experiment with natural sunlight spectrum for seedlings or clones.
  • You're willing to budget for regular bulb replacements.

Budget LED strips might work if:

  • You're on a tight budget and can handle higher failure rates and lower efficiency.
  • Your operation is small (under 500 sq ft) and electricity is cheap.
  • You're growing low-light crops like microgreens or herbs.
  • You're willing to replace strips every 12-18 months.
"I recommend Gavita for serious commercial production. But if you're doing a small home setup on a tight budget, a quality LED strip from a reputable horticulture brand could work. Just know what you're trading off."

Final Thoughts (and a Confession)

After all this analysis, we're standardizing on Gavita Pro RS 2400e for our main production rooms. The decision came down to efficiency, durability, and the fact that our head grower trusts the spectrum. But we kept two plasma units for the propagation area—they genuinely seem to help with root development in clones.

The budget LED strips? We phased them out. The savings weren't real once you accounted for replacement costs and yield loss.

Bottom line: there's no universal "best" light. But if you're running a commercial operation and you want to minimize headaches and maximize ROI over 3+ years, Gavita's price premium is worth it. At least, that's been my experience in our specific context. Your mileage may vary if you're in a different climate, crop type, or scale.
